This role leads the Enterprise Product Led Tooling workstream, shaping and delivering the strategic tooling ecosystem that underpins LSEG's Product Led Transformation. It establishes an integrated, enterprise wide tooling capability spanning all enterprise systems and supports product lifecycle workflows across the end to end lifecycle in all divisions.
Responsibilities
- Lead the Enterprise Product Led Tooling workstream, defining and evolving the future state tooling ecosystem.
- Own delivery of Tooling MVP iterations across enterprise tools such as Clarity, Planview, Jira, Confluence, Asana, GitLab, Snowflake, Service Now, Service Cloud and others.
- Manage the enterprise work hierarchy and workflows in alignment with LSEG's business and product hierarchies.
- Partner with Product Led Transformation, Group Investment Management, Engineering, Operations and other Group functions to design workflows, governance and supporting processes.
- Lead onboarding waves across First Movers, Pilot Areas and other business units - stakeholder engagement, migration and adoption planning, training, organizational change management.
- Govern standards for backlog management, OKRs, road mapping, funding workflows, reporting and integrated delivery metrics.
- Coordinate governance and cross workstream forums (SteerCo, ExCo, design forums, technical deep dives) to ensure alignment and decision making.
- Provide transparency of priorities, actions, risks, dependencies and progress for senior leadership.
- Manage vendor interactions including licensing, commercial approvals, implementation timelines and support model.
- Ensure compliance with audit, security and data governance requirements.
